PROJECT Overview

The Falcon was built for the Hot Rod Power Tour, so that we could show up in a cool car that was out of our normal character of a Camaro or Mustang. “Nobody expected me bring a beat-up old Falcon to the Power Tour, so that’s what we built,” Jon said. Found in Roswell, NM where it had been sitting for years in a field, the “barn find,” if you will, was turned into a righteous street driver with a 347ci stroker, a TCI front end, Wilwood brakes all around, and amenities like cruise control, air conditioning and modern gauges. The Falcon is Jon’s daily driver (along with his 1985 Chevy truck) and can be driven cross-country at any time. When asked when he plans to paint the car, Jon just explains the care procedure for the original patina—spray it down with WD40 once a month and that’s it. It keeps it looking like it is, and keeps it from ever rusting!”
